[改进后的中文总结内容]

会议纪要

会议时间: 2019年4月18日

参会人员: Adam(Ceph研发人员),其他Ceph团队成员

会议内容

1. Pull Requests审核

  • 新提交的Pull Requests
    • 一项通过在用户空间而非内核空间拉取事件的Pull Requests,实现了异步消息传递性能的提升。
    • 一项优化UTF-8检查的Pull Requests,旨在提高系统性能。
  • 已审核的Pull Requests
    • 推迟延迟请求的Pull Requests,由Jason审核。
    • 优化默认垃圾回收策略的Pull Requests,已解决先前存在的问题。

2. Adam的RocksDB工作

  • Adam测试了将RocksDB数据库分割成多个列族对性能的影响。
  • 测试结果表明,分割列族可以带来性能提升,最高可达29%。
  • Adam探讨了列族大小和写前锁对性能的影响,发现更大的写前锁和更少的列族可以显著提升性能。

3. RocksDB的压缩和扩展

  • 团队讨论了RocksDB的压缩和扩展问题,并探讨如何通过调整配置来优化性能。
  • Adam提出,通过调整写前锁大小和列族配置,可以减少数据移动,提高压缩效率。

4. Ceph性能和稳定性

  • 团队讨论了Ceph的性能和稳定性问题,并探讨如何改进系统性能和可靠性。
  • Adam提出,通过增加超时时间和优化超时策略,可以避免因长时间等待而导致的服务中断。

5. 其他议题

  • 团队讨论了其他议题,包括:
    • MDS缓存内存限制
    • 内存自动调优
    • 集群性能测试

后续行动计划

  • Adam将继续测试RocksDB分割列族对性能的影响,并优化相关配置。
  • 团队将继续改进Ceph的性能和稳定性。
  • 团队将继续关注其他议题,并制定相应的解决方案。

关键词

  • Pull Requests
  • RocksDB
  • 列族
  • 写前锁
  • 压缩
  • 扩展
  • Ceph
  • 性能
  • 稳定性
  • MDS
  • 内存自动调优